MySQL执行备份报错:Error number24 means 'too many open files'

栏目:云苍穹知识作者:金蝶来源:金蝶云社区发布:2024-09-23浏览:1

MySQL执行备份报错:Error number24 means 'too many open files'

可修改如下参数


1、配置文件:/etc/sysctl.conf加入:    (sysctl -p 生效) fs.file-max = 655360 


2、修改操作系统的最大打开文件数 /etc/security/limits.conf文件  (ulimt -SHn 655360临时生效,重启操作系统永久生效,值不能超过1048576)

 *      soft     nproc              655360

 *      hard     nproc              655360

 *      soft     nofile             655360

 *      hard     nofile             655360 


3、修改系统服务 /usr/lib/systemd/system/mysqld.service 在[service]下面增加 LimitCORE=infinity LimitNOFILE=655350 LimitNPROC=655350 


4、修改/etc/systemd/system.conf 增加 DefaultLimitCORE=infinity DefaultLimitNOFILE=655360   --请检查此数据与uilimit一致 DefaultLimitNPROC=655360  --请检查此数据与uilimit一致


5、修改my.conf
innodb_open-files=65535
open_files_limit=200000


MySQL执行备份报错:Error number24 means 'too many open files'

可修改如下参数1、配置文件:/etc/sysctl.conf加入: (sysctl -p 生效)fs.file-max = 655360 2、修改操作系统的最大打开文件数...
点击下载文档
确认删除?
回到顶部
客服QQ
  • 客服QQ点击这里给我发消息